In its relentless pursuit of a better and sustainable future, CW Enerji continues to make significant strides in renewable energy initiatives across Turkey. The latest endeavor involves the completion of a solar power plant installation with a capacity of 1481.31 kWp on the roof of a company based in Edirne.

With a commitment to spreading solar power solutions nationwide, CW Enerji aims to foster a greener environment and meet the escalating demand for renewable energy in Turkey. Volkan Yฤฑlmaz, CEO of CW Enerji, highlighted the pivotal role of solar energy in this transformative journey. “As CW Energy, we contribute to this transformation with each solar power plant we install,” said Yฤฑlmaz. “By deploying CW Energy solar panels throughout the country, we adopt an environmentally friendly approach while fulfilling the energy requirements of our nation.”

Yฤฑlmaz emphasized the company’s dedication to technological innovation, enabling the development of projects in diverse regions of Turkey to support sustainable energy production. The installation of the 1481.31 kWp solar power plant on the roof of the Edirne-based company signifies a significant step towards reducing carbon emissions and embracing clean energy solutions.

“We are proud to announce the completion of the solar power plant installation, which will enable the company to save approximately 123 trees annually and prevent the emission of 813,353 kg of carbon dioxide equivalent,” stated Yฤฑlmaz. With this initiative, the company anticipates meeting a substantial portion of its electricity needs through solar panels, further solidifying its commitment to environmental stewardship and sustainable energy practices.
